    If you are lucky enough to make it to the Sapporo Snow Festival, you might be considering what else you should be doing (if you can’t go, just try to enjoy the photo anyway). Most of the snow sculptures are located at Odori Park and of course seeing them up close is great, but also it is worth it to go up to the top of the Sapporo TV Tower at the edge of the park and get this kind of view.

    Sapporo TV Tower Night View by Evan Pike

    The Sapporo TV Tower (not to be confused with the Clock Tower–which might be the most overrated “tourist spot” in Japan) is like a mini Eiffel Tower and offers a great view of Sapporo during the day or night.
